Abstract

The application relates to the field of data processing, and provides a member configuration method, device, equipment and storage medium of a service processing system, wherein the method comprises the following steps: determining a member selection list according to the characteristic information of the members; the characteristic information is determined according to corresponding data of members in a human resource management system associated with the service processing system; generating a member configuration component corresponding to the service processing system according to the member selection lists; and carrying out member configuration on the service processing system according to the operation information of the user on the member configuration component so as to improve the configuration efficiency of member configuration on the service processing system.

As shown in fig. 1, the member configuration method of the service processing system includes steps S101 to S103.
Step S101, determining a member selection list according to the characteristic information of the members; the characteristic information is determined from corresponding data of members in a human resource management system associated with the business processing system.
For example, the corresponding data of the members may be uniformly managed by the human resource management system. For example, the human resource management system may uniformly manage data of historical configuration data, department data, week report data, authority data, group data, and the like of members. Based on the above, the association relationship between the service processing system and the human resource management system can be established, and then the service processing system can acquire the corresponding data of the member according to the associated human resource management system. Of course, the present application is not limited thereto, and for example, the human resource management system may determine corresponding data of members in the human resource management system based on the related data in the service processing system. Taking the historical configuration data as an example, the human resource management system can establish an association relationship with a plurality of service processing systems, and different service processing systems can configure the same member, for example, the human resource management system can respectively acquire the historical configuration data generated by the plurality of service processing systems for configuring the member, so as to determine the historical configuration data of the member. Taking the authority data as an example, the human resource management system may establish an association relationship with a plurality of service processing systems, and the authorities of the same member in different service processing systems may be different, so that the human resource management system may respectively obtain the authority data corresponding to the member in the plurality of service processing systems, so as to determine the authority data of the member, which is not limited herein.
In some embodiments, the service processing system may determine the characteristic information of the member according to the acquired corresponding data of the member. For example, the service processing system may determine the historical configuration frequency of the member according to the historical configuration data of the member when the historical configuration information of the member is obtained. The service processing system is not limited to this, and may determine the department information of the member according to the department data of the member in the case of acquiring the department data of the member, which is not limited herein.
For example, in the case where the feature information of the member is determined, the service processing system may determine different member selection lists according to different feature information of the member. In the process of member configuration of the service processing system, members in different member selection lists can be selected without searching members one by one.
Therefore, the member selection list is determined according to the characteristic information of the members, and convenience in member configuration of the service processing system is improved.
The characteristic information includes at least one of a history configuration frequency of the member, department information of the member, project information of the member, role information of the member, group information of the member, for example.
In some embodiments, the member selection list is determined from a preset member whose historical configuration frequency is greater than or equal to a preset configuration frequency threshold.
For example, the business processing system may obtain historical configuration data for the member. For example, the historical configuration data may be analyzed by a data analysis function to determine the historical configuration frequency of the member. In the case where the history configuration frequency of the member is determined, a preset member whose history configuration frequency is greater than or equal to a preset configuration frequency threshold value may be selected from the plurality of members according to the history configuration frequency of the member, and the member selection list may be determined.
Taking the insurance renewal service as an example, when a user processes the insurance renewal service through the service processing system, for example, the user does not understand related insurance renewal regulations, and can request help from customer service personnel for processing the insurance renewal service through the service processing system. Based on this, members may be configured for the premium service of the service processing system. For example, historical configuration frequencies for a plurality of members may be obtained. And under the condition that the historical configuration frequency of the existing members is greater than or equal to the preset configuration frequency threshold, determining that the members with the historical configuration frequency greater than or equal to the preset configuration frequency threshold are preset members, and generating a member selection list according to the preset members. For example, when a member is subsequently configured for a premium service of a service processing system, the corresponding member may be selected according to a member selection list. Of course, the present invention is not limited thereto.
For example, when the total number of preset members whose history configuration frequency is greater than or equal to the preset configuration frequency threshold is greater than the preset number threshold, selecting the preset members of the preset number threshold according to the history configuration frequency of the preset members, and generating the member selection list. In an exemplary embodiment, when the total number of preset members whose historical configuration frequency is greater than or equal to the preset configuration frequency threshold is greater, if a member selection list is generated according to all preset members, then when the members are configured for the service processing system, if the members to be configured are selected according to the member selection list, a situation that more time or effort is required to select the members to be configured is easy to occur. Based on this, the number of preset members in the member selection list can be limited. For example, the preset members may be ordered from high to low according to the history configuration frequency of the preset members to obtain a preset member queue, and preset members with a higher history configuration frequency and a preset number threshold in the preset member queue, such as the first 30 members in the preset member queue, are selected to generate the member selection list. Of course, the method is not limited thereto, for example, the history configuration data of the member may be updated, and the history configuration frequency of the corresponding member may be updated, for example, the history configuration frequency of the member may be determined according to the history configuration data of the member acquired recently in a preset period of time, which is not limited thereto.
Therefore, the member selection list is determined according to the preset members with the historical configuration frequency larger than or equal to the preset configuration frequency threshold, and the corresponding member determination member selection list can be selected according to the historical configuration frequency of the members, so that the convenience and the flexibility of generating the member selection list are improved.
In some embodiments, the members are grouped according to their department information to obtain department grouping results, and the member selection list is determined according to the department grouping results.
For example, the business processing system may obtain department data for the member. For example, the department data may be analyzed by a data analysis function to determine the department information of the member. Under the condition that the department information of the members is determined, different members can be grouped according to the department information of the members to obtain department grouping results, so that a member selection list is determined according to the department grouping results.
Taking an insurance claim settlement service as an example, the insurance claim settlement service can comprise different claim settlement types, such as car insurance, insurance production, medical insurance and the like, and the processing personnel of the different claim settlement types can be members of different departments, so that the members can be grouped according to the department information of the members to obtain a department grouping result. For example, in the case where it is determined that the department to which the member belongs is a car insurance claim department according to the department information of the member, the member may be divided into department groups corresponding to the car insurance claim departments. In the case that the department to which the member belongs is determined to be the department for producing the insurance claim according to the department information of the member, the member may be divided into the department groups corresponding to the department for producing the insurance claim. And so on, so that the member selection list can be determined according to the department groups corresponding to the different members. For example, the members of the corresponding departments may be selected based on a member selection list when the members are subsequently configured for an insurance claim service of the service processing system. Of course, the present invention is not limited thereto.
For example, in the case where the member selection list is determined based on the division grouping result, the member selection list may be determined based on the division grouping result and the division architecture information. The department architecture information may be obtained from a human resource management system, and is not limited herein. In an exemplary embodiment, the department architecture information may include an insurance claim department, which may be divided into a car insurance claim department, a production insurance claim department, etc., and the department grouping results may be arranged in combination with the department architecture information to determine the member selection list. For example, the member selection list may take the department architecture information as a frame, take the total division structure, determine the insurance claim department as a total node, take the vehicle insurance claim department and the production claim department as parallel division nodes, determine the members of the departments belonging to the vehicle insurance claim department as options under the division nodes of the vehicle insurance claim department, and determine the members of the departments belonging to the production claim department as options under the division nodes of the production claim department, which is not limited to this, for example, different nodes in the member selection list such as the department architecture information and the department group may be displayed in a folding manner, which is not limited herein.
Therefore, the members are grouped according to the department information of the members, a department grouping result is obtained, and the member selection list is determined according to the department grouping result, so that the member selection list can be determined according to the departments to which the members belong, and the convenience and the flexibility of determining the member selection list are improved.

In some embodiments, the member configuration components corresponding to the service processing systems are integrated into external service processing systems except the service processing systems, so as to obtain the member configuration components corresponding to the external service processing systems.
For example, an external service processing system other than the service processing system, for example, also has a member configuration requirement, and then the member configuration component corresponding to the service processing system may be integrated into the external service processing system to determine the member configuration component corresponding to the external service processing system. Based on the above, the external service processing system can perform member configuration on the external service processing system according to the member configuration component corresponding to the external service processing system.
Therefore, the member configuration components corresponding to the service processing system are integrated to the external service processing system, so that the convenience degree of determining the member configuration components corresponding to the external service processing system is improved, and the convenience degree of member configuration of the external service processing system is improved.
For example, according to the interface display parameters corresponding to the external service processing system, the member configuration components corresponding to the service processing system are adjusted to obtain the member configuration components corresponding to the external service processing system.
In some embodiments, the interface display parameters corresponding to the service processing system and the interface display parameters corresponding to the external service processing system may be different, and when the member configuration component corresponding to the service processing system is integrated into the external service processing system, the member configuration component corresponding to the service processing system may be adaptively adjusted.
By way of example, the interface display parameters may include size information, arrangement direction information, color information, and the like, without limitation.
For example, as shown in fig. 3, the arrangement direction information corresponding to the service processing system is a transverse arrangement, and the arrangement direction information corresponding to the external service processing system is a longitudinal arrangement, so that the member configuration components corresponding to the service processing system can be adjusted from the transverse arrangement to the longitudinal arrangement, so as to adapt to the interface design style of the external processing system, and obtain the member configuration components corresponding to the external processing system. Of course, the method is not limited thereto, for example, the color information corresponding to the service processing system is orange, and the color information corresponding to the external service processing system is blue, and the member configuration component corresponding to the service processing system may be adjusted from orange to blue to adapt to the interface design style of the external processing system, so as to obtain the member configuration component corresponding to the external processing system, which is not limited herein.
Thus, according to the interface display parameters corresponding to the external service processing system, the member configuration components corresponding to the service processing system are adjusted to obtain the member configuration components corresponding to the external service processing system, so that convenience in determining the member configuration components corresponding to the external service processing system is improved, and configuration efficiency in member configuration of the external service processing system is improved.
